WebIt is a system in which sets of interconnected components are interacting to form a unified whole. Earth is comprised of four major smaller systems known as subsystems. These are also called as spheres of the Earth. These are the atmosphere, geosphere, hydrosphere, and biosphere. o This is what makes the life on earth possible . WebEarth is a complex system of interacting living organisms and nonliving materials. Scientists break down Earth’s major systems into four; the geosphere, hydrosphere, atmosphere, and biosphere. The geosphere, also called the lithosphere, includes all Earth’s rock, soil and sand in all its forms from mountains to its rocky stream beds ...
WebJan 26, 2024 · Lithosphere, biosphere, hydrosphere, and atmosphere. Explanation: Lithosphere: The rigid outer part of Earth, consists of the surface, the crust and the upper mantle. Biosphere: The regions that contain life Hydrosphere: Region that contains water, can be in the form of solid (Antarctica), liquid (oceans), and gas (the atmosphere).
